Html 谷歌地图可以';我不能正确地移动地图

Html 谷歌地图可以';我不能正确地移动地图,html,css,google-maps,google-maps-api-3,Html,Css,Google Maps,Google Maps Api 3,这是一把小提琴 问题是,当我尝试移动地图时(请在中查看),地图会移动,然后自动返回其位置,并且地图不适合空间 我没有一个css的地图,除了宽度和高度 你能帮忙吗 地图位于jfiddle中的按钮lastNext 编辑 map的代码非常简单,如果您不知道,请告诉我告诉您删除脚本: <script> function initialize() { var map_canvas = document.getEl

这是一把小提琴

问题是,当我尝试移动地图时(请在中查看),地图会移动,然后自动返回其位置,并且地图不适合空间

我没有一个css的地图,除了宽度和高度

你能帮忙吗

地图位于jfiddle中的按钮last
Next

编辑 map的代码非常简单,如果您不知道,请告诉我告诉您删除脚本:

            <script>
            function initialize() {
                var map_canvas = document.getElementById('map_canvas');
                var map_options = {
                    center: new google.maps.LatLng(44.5403, -78.5463),
                    zoom: 8,
                    mapTypeId: google.maps.MapTypeId.ROADMAP
                }
                var map = new google.maps.Map(map_canvas, map_options);
            }
            google.maps.event.addDomListener(window, 'load', initialize);
        </script>
添加

if ($('fieldset').index($(this).parents('fieldset'))==2){
      var map_canvas = document.getElementById('map_canvas');
      var map_options = {
      center: new google.maps.LatLng(44.5403, -78.5463),
      zoom: 8,
      mapTypeId: google.maps.MapTypeId.ROADMAP
      }
      var map = new google.maps.Map(map_canvas, map_options);
}  

工作示例:

你能帮个忙吗?为什么你要将
==2
设置为please?这只解决了一次,我的意思是,当你到达最后一个并单击“上一个”,然后再次单击“下一个”时,问题将在最后一个字段集的索引中再次触发。如果你到达最后一个你不能进入前一个,我只看到提交按钮如果你添加上一个按钮这是一个新问题:)索引是3不是2对吗?如果我在最后一个问题上单击“上一个”,然后单击“下一个”,那么为什么问题会再次出现?请先问一下为什么会出现问题?我做错了什么?
if ($('fieldset').index($(this).parents('fieldset'))==2){
      var map_canvas = document.getElementById('map_canvas');
      var map_options = {
      center: new google.maps.LatLng(44.5403, -78.5463),
      zoom: 8,
      mapTypeId: google.maps.MapTypeId.ROADMAP
      }
      var map = new google.maps.Map(map_canvas, map_options);
}